Teaching tips for Oscillations and Waves

  • 1Use examples of Indian musical instruments to explain oscillations and sound waves
  • 2Conduct a simple experiment demonstrating wave propagation using local materials like water in a pot
  • 3Discuss the relevance of seismic waves in earthquake-prone regions of India, such as Uttarakhand and Gujarat

Board exam relevance

Questions may include MCQs on definitions, short answer questions on wave properties, and numerical problems related to oscillation frequency and amplitude.
